Reposted from Kristoffer Pasion
#TodayinHistory in 1986, the human barricades across the intersection of Ortigas Ave. & EDSA forced the 12 tanks sent by dictator Ferdinand Marcos Sr. to pull back. It’s the 2nd Day of the EDSA People Power Revolution in the Philippines. www.facebook.com/share/p/12G6... #Edusky #democracy

Comments